Cornyn won’t commit to backing Paxton if Trump-endorsed AG wins primary
Sen. John Cornyn (R-Texas) refused to commit to supporting Trump-endorsed Attorney General Ken Paxton (R) in the upcoming Texas Republican Senate runoff election against Democrat James Talarico. Cornyn's hesitation highlights potential tensions between Trump's influence and Senate candidates' autonomy.
